A rectangle or table top has a length of 4 3/4 feet in an area of 11 7/8 ft. what is the width of the table top?

11 7/8 ÷ 4 3/4 =2 1/2

Using a quadratic regression equation, it is found that the prediction of volunteers in year 10 is of:

A. 47.

<h3>How to find the equation of quadratic regression using a calculator?</h3>

To find the equation, we need to insert the points (x,y) in the calculator.

In this problem, we have that the function initially increases, then it decreases, which means that it is a quadratic function. The points (x,y) to  be inserted into the calculator are given as follows:

(1, 20), (2,17), (3, 16), (4,16), (5,18), (6,21), (7,25), (8,31)

Inserting these points into the calculator, the prediction of y for a value of x is given as follows:

y = 0.702x^2 - 4.726x + 23.857

Hence, when x = 10, the prediction is:

y = 0.702 x 10² - 4.726 x 10 + 23.857

y = 47.

Hence option A is correct.
